    I am VERY new to all of this and am trying to figure out how to make videos smaller in order to fit on a DVDin Architect 4.5. I am making a menu based DVD out of several clips, ranging from 6-60 minutes in length. I am filling the DVD 104%. For the life of me I cannot figure out how to get all the videos to fit. Can anyone hold my hand through the process? It would be most appreciated.

    DVDs are MPEG2. MPEG2 can vary in size based on the bitrates used. So simply use the proper bitrate for the length of your video. There’s lots of info in Vol 1 #7 of my newsletters and there’s another issue about going from Vegas to DVD Architect to create a DVD.
